Love Your Waterfront Episode 9:

Tele Aadsen & What Water Holds


Dan and Kevin kick off 2024 with news about federal funds for the local fishing industry and an exciting event: Fire & Story, and arts event on the Bellingham Waterfront. Speaking of Fisherpoets, commercial fisherman and author Tele Aadsen visits KMRE to talk about her life on the water in her new book, "What Water Holds."
